Ingredients
  

For the Dumplings:

2 cups all-purpose flour

1/2 tsp salt

1/2 cup boiling water

1 tbsp vegetable oil

For the Filling:

1 cup cooked chicken, shredded

1/2 cup finely chopped spinach

1/4 cup minced garlic

1 tsp grated ginger

1 tbsp curry powder

Salt and pepper to taste

For the Soup:

4 cups chicken broth

1 can (14 oz) coconut milk

1 medium onion, chopped

2 carrots, sliced

1 red bell pepper, diced

2 tbsp curry paste (adjust to taste)

1 tbsp soy sauce

Fresh cilantro for garnish

Lime wedges for serving

Instructions
 

Make the Dumpling Dough: In a bowl, combine the flour and salt. Gradually pour in the boiling water, stirring with a fork until a rough dough forms. Add the vegetable oil and knead for about 5 minutes until smooth. Cover with a damp cloth and let rest for at least 30 minutes.

    Prepare the Filling: In a mixing bowl, combine the shredded chicken, chopped spinach, minced garlic, ginger, curry powder, salt, and pepper. Mix well and set aside.

      Roll Out the Dumplings: On a lightly floured surface, divide the dough into small portions. Roll each portion into a thin circle (about 3 inches in diameter). Place about 1 tsp of filling in the center of each circle. Fold the dough over to create a half-moon shape and pinch the edges to seal. Make sure there are no air pockets.

        Prepare the Soup Base: In a large pot over medium heat, add a drizzle of oil. Sauté the chopped onion until translucent. Then add the sliced carrots and diced bell pepper, cooking until they start to soften.

          Add Broth and Seasonings: Pour in the chicken broth and coconut milk. Stir in the curry paste and soy sauce. Bring the mixture to a simmer.

            Cook the Dumplings: Gently drop the prepared dumplings into the simmering soup. Allow them to cook for about 8-10 minutes, or until they float to the top and are fully cooked through.

              Final Touches: Taste the soup and adjust seasoning if necessary. Remove from heat and let it cool for a few minutes.

                Serve: Ladle the soup into bowls. Garnish with fresh cilantro and serve with lime wedges for a burst of freshness.

                  Prep Time: 30 min | Total Time: 1 hour | Servings: 4
